GENERAL DESCRIPTION
The
NJM2525
is 4ch video amplifier with SD/HD LPF.
The
NJM2525
includes 2in-1out selector for the composite and
component signal. The isolation amplifier eliminates the common
mode noise from external equipment.
The
NJM2525
is suitable for the AV equipment such as the home
theater systems and AV receivers that switch the internal Video signal
and the external Video signal.
